Emil Velikov b93be14b7d xfree86/parser: annotate xf86ConfigSymTabRec as constant data
Add the const notation to all the static storage as well as the
functions that use it - xf86getToken(), xf86getSubTokenWithTab(),
StringToToken() and xf86getStringToken().

Reviewed-by: Alex Deucher <alexander.deucher@amd.com>
Signed-off-by: Emil Velikov <emil.l.velikov@gmail.com>
